Legal Framework Governing Standards Enforcement
The legal framework governing standards enforcement in air quality regulation is primarily rooted in federal legislation, notably the Clean Air Act (CAA) of 1970. This legislation authorizes the EPA to set permissible emission limits to protect public health and the environment. It also establishes states’ roles in implementing and enforcing these standards.
EPA regulations derive their authority from the CAA, creating a comprehensive system for establishing, monitoring, and enforcing air quality standards. These standards are legally binding, with enforcement mechanisms that include inspections, penalties, and corrective orders. The framework provides a clear legal basis for holding violators accountable and ensuring compliance.
Additionally, legal provisions enable the EPA to collaborate with state and local agencies in enforcement activities. This multi-layered approach strengthens the efficacy of standards enforcement, ensuring that air quality regulations are upheld consistently across jurisdictions. The legal framework thus ensures a robust, enforceable system aligned with national environmental and public health protection goals.

Inspection and Monitoring Procedures
Inspection and monitoring procedures are integral components of enforcing air quality standards under EPA regulations. They ensure compliance by systematically evaluating emission sources and ambient air conditions. These procedures include scheduled and unannounced inspections conducted by EPA officials or authorized state agencies.
During inspections, authorities examine facilities’ operational practices, review records, and verify adherence to permit conditions. Monitoring also involves collecting ambient air samples at strategic locations to assess pollutant levels against permissible limits. Data gathered through these activities provides concrete evidence for enforcement actions if violations are detected.
Key aspects of inspection and monitoring procedures include:
- Routine inspections of industrial facilities, transportation hubs, and other emission sources.
- On-site sampling and measurements using calibrated equipment.
- Reviewing operational logs, maintenance records, and compliance reports.
- Deploying stationary and mobile air quality monitors to track pollutant concentrations over time.
These procedures help ensure accurate assessment of compliance, facilitate transparency, and form the basis for enforcement actions under EPA regulations.
Penalties and Corrective Actions
Penalties and corrective actions are integral components of the EPA’s approach to enforcing air quality standards. When violations occur, the agency deploys a range of enforcement tools designed to ensure compliance and protect public health. These may include monetary fines, legal orders to cease harmful activities, or mandates to implement specific corrective measures.
The severity of penalties typically depends on the nature, extent, and frequency of violations. Violations involving willful disregard or persistent non-compliance often result in higher fines or legal action. Corrective actions may involve installing pollution controls, upgrading equipment, or adopting operational changes to reduce emissions. Such measures aim to restore compliance and prevent future violations.
Enforcement agencies may also utilize administrative orders, consent decrees, or negotiated settlements to resolve violations expediently. These agreements often outline specific corrective steps, compliance deadlines, and potential penalties. Overall, penalties and corrective actions serve as vital deterrents and ensure accountability in meeting air quality standards under EPA regulations.

Legal Consequences of Violating Air Quality Standards
Violating air quality standards can lead to significant legal consequences under EPA regulations. Such violations typically trigger administrative, civil, or criminal actions against responsible parties. The severity of penalties depends on the nature and extent of non-compliance, as well as the entity’s history of violations.
Administrative penalties may include fines, compliance orders, or mandates to implement corrective measures. Civil penalties generally involve monetary fines imposed through legal proceedings, which can escalate with repeated violations. Criminal sanctions are reserved for egregious or willful offenses, potentially leading to substantial fines or imprisonment.
The enforcement framework emphasizes accountability, with EPA or state agencies authorized to inspect facilities, issue violation notices, and initiate legal proceedings. Offenders must often demonstrate efforts to rectify violations within specified timeframes to mitigate penalties. Persistent or severe violations can result in lawsuits, stricter enforcement actions, or even facility shutdowns, underscoring the importance of adhering to air quality standards under EPA regulations.
